Ramjin Rural District
Ramjin Rural District is in Ramjin District of Chaharbagh County, Alborz province, Iran. Its capital is the village of Ramjin.
Demographics
Population
At the time of the 2006 National Census, the rural district's population was 16,960 in 4,294 households. The 2016 census measured the population of the rural district as 23,348 in 7,347 households, by which time the county had been separated from the province in the establishment of Alborz province. The most populous of its 23 villages was Lashkarabad, with 7,198 people.In 2020, the district was separated from the county in establishing Chaharbagh County and renamed the Central District. The rural district was transferred to the new Ramjin District.
